Output 75854992dac3c69dd3d018b3c6f66ec1917d30e63769836f67b0b33c75f25834:13

value
18588169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3768bf169106af9f25ae5255fefc22af0bbb8 OP_EQUAL
address
3BMEXoAimcS11iAhrW3GkjyUmBqdpxdaGj
transaction
75854992dac3c69dd3d018b3c6f66ec1917d30e63769836f67b0b33c75f25834
spent
true